[12][13], In June 2008, Angel Trains was acquired by a consortium of Babcock & Brown, AMP Capital, Arcus European Infrastructure Fund and Deutsche Bank at a reported cost of 3.6 billion. [4][5][6], By September 1996, Angel Trains had contracts in place with 19 of the 25 train operating companies in the UK, and owned approximately 3,755 vehicles, a third of which were less than eight years old at that time.

[7], During December 1997, Angel Trains was purchased by the financial services group Royal Bank of Scotland in exchange for 395 million. [4], The trains feature a hydraulic transmission[2] supplied by Voith, which is a three-speed type, with integral hydrodynamic braking (rated at 750kW short term, 420kW continuous). BRITISH rolling stock leasing company Angel Trains announced on August 18 that two of its existing shareholders, Australian pension fund AMP Capital Investors and PSP Investments, Canada, have acquired the entire stake previously held by Arcus European Infrastructure Fund. Less than one year after the acquisition, Nomura was already examining options to merge or sell on Angel Trains, or form a joint venture with a train operating company (TOC); it had reportedly encouraged by the recent sale of other ROSCOs, such as Porterbrook to Stagecoach in addition to alleged approaches by unidentified third parties.
